I migrated to a new Mac mini but my email password did not. Can I go into mail on my old computer(which still works) and retrieve my password?

So, assuming you've used no 3rd party Password Managers, go into the old Mac > Utilities > Keychain Access and search for Mail and then look through the results. Once you have the right account, right-click and select Get Info and in the Attributes tab, there is a Password field, check the box beside it to show the password.


Now, make sure to write down the password and your Account details. I say this as you should make sure to have a secure backup Password Manager (be it provided by Apple via Keychain Access or a 3rd Party like 1Password or LastPass).
